The kalimba, a miniature musical instrument known for its delicate sound, has won over hearts worldwide. With its wooden keys and easy to learn design, the kalimba is accessible to players of all ages. The harmonious notes it produces create a sense of calm, making it a perfect choice for relaxation, meditation, or simply enjoying music.

Exploring the History and Culture of the Kalimba

The kalimba, dubbed as a thumb piano, features a rich history and cultural significance that stretches centuries. Originating in Africa, the instrument has been various tribes for both ceremonial purposes.

Individual kalimba is constructed from diverse materials, commonly wood. The keys, which are carefully tuned to produce unique notes, are attached to a base. The kalimba's delicate sound has been praised for its serenity.

Over time, the kalimba has evolved and gained recognition as different cultures. Today, it holds its place as a beloved instrument for both contemporary artists.
